"Strikebreaker" is a science fictionshort story by American writer Isaac Asimov.

It was first published in the January 1957 issue of The Original Science Fiction Stories under the title "Male Strikebreaker" and reprinted in the 1969 collection Nightfall and Other Stories under the original title "Strikebreaker".
Asimov has stated the editorial decision to run the story as "Male Strikebreaker" "represents my personal record for stupid title changes".[1]
"Strikebreaker" had its genesis in June 1956 when Asimov, who then lived in Boston, Massachusetts, was planning a trip to New York City.
